Output 28f96d2cda415cf2142d54ab33aaf364c884685b29274c3f63c6ce4a6a333836:0

value
8000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f745894905b15959636a9a018f4bd1d239e1a543 OP_EQUAL
address
3QEU8PcNYnnwnbSKc6GnnMuYQoEnoLsJab
transaction
28f96d2cda415cf2142d54ab33aaf364c884685b29274c3f63c6ce4a6a333836
spent
true